Nov 3, 2007 Peach Belt Cross Country Teams Run at NCAA RegionalsHUNTSVILLE, ALA -- Columbus State finished 10th and GCSU 11th at
the 2007 NCAA South Region Championships which were run in
Huntsville on Saturday. Florida Southern won the event with
61 points and earned a spot in the NCAA National Championships in
Joplin, Mo. Alabama-Huntsville and Tampa also earned spots in
the nationals. Unfortunately, no PBC teams or runners
qualified for the final meet.
Columbus State's Stewart Helton was the top PBC runner in the
region, covering the 10k course in 33:59 to finish 24th.
GCSU's Josh Hollar was 26th in a time of 34:12. Emmanuel
Kirwa of Benedict won the race in a time of 31:53.
North Georgia finished 15th while Clayton State was 16th and
Francis Marion 18th at the regional.
